- 14.4 AVENGER JUSTICE
- Syntax:
- o PK STATUS
- Shows whether you are careful or not and lists suspects and those upon whom
- you can claim vengeance. Also shows whose lists you are on as a suspect.
- o PK CAREFUL [ON/OFF]
- Sets your PK carefulness. If you turn on being careful then Avechna will
- warn you when you try to attack someone who lists you as a suspect, telling
- you to stay your hand. In other words, it will make it impossible for you
- to initiate an attack that would cause the target to gain vengeance
- against you. Having it off, of course, means you can initiate an
- attack with anyone, regardless of the consequences.
- o VENGEANCE UPON <target>
- Calls an Avatar of Avechna to claim vengeance.
- Lusternia operates with a PvP (player vs. player) policy with an innovative
- twist, which is called the Avenger Justice System. Avechna the Avenger has been
- charged with protecting the prime material plane against oppressors. An
- oppressor is someone who repeatedly kills or attacks another. What this means
- is that if you were killed on the prime material plane, you will be under the
- protection of the Avenger against that person for one RL month. That person is
- now a "suspect". The FIRST hostile action against you by a suspect will allow
- you to call the Avenger once. If you do not respond with any hostile action and
- die to that person, you may call the Avenger a second time. If you initiate a
- hostile action against a suspect (except in "open PK zones; see below), the
- Avenger will assume you are taking matters in your own hands and remove that
- person as a suspect. Note that the Avenger will attempt to detect if a team has
- cooperated to slay someone and will treat all of them the same as it treats the
- individual killer.
- To claim vengeance, you must travel to the top of Avenger Peak and invoke
- VENGEANCE UPON <oppressor>. The Avenger will then, at some point in the
- near future, surprise that person by descending on him and killing him.
- Further, the Avenger will award you approximately the amount of experience
- you lost by the oppressor. Depending upon the number of suspects on his list,
- your oppressor may also find himself pacified for a period.
- Examples:
- o If Galt kills Chade, then Galt is placed on Chade's Suspect list.
- After 30 days, Galt is taken off Chade's Suspect list.
- o If Galt makes any hostile attack on Chade while on Chade's Suspect
- list, Galt is then placed on Chade's Vengeance list.
- o o Chade may now invoke the Avenger at his leisure (Chade must travel
- to the Avenger and invoke "VENGEANCE UPON GALT").
- !!!NOTE!!! Galt remains on Chade's Suspect list but subsequent
- hostile actions (that don't kill Chade) won't allow
- Chade to *stack* Galt's name more than once until Chade
- invokes vengeance (after which Galt can again be placed
- on Chade's Vengeance list by making yet another hostile
- action against Chade).
- o If Galt kills Chade, then Chade can invoke the Avenger twice against
- Galt, once for a hostile action and once for the death.
- !!!NOTE!!! Galt remains on Chade's Suspect list so long as Chade
- has not made any hostile action in return.
- o The only way Galt's name can be taken off Chade's Suspect list is if
- Chade makes any hostile action against Galt. If Chade is first
- attacked by Galt and then attacks Galt in self-defense (instead of
- running away), Galt will be placed once on Chade's vengeance list but
- taken off Chade's Suspect list. If Chade attacks Galt first, Galt is
- taken off Chade's Suspect list and may kill Chade again at any time
- without fear of Chade taking vengeance.
- In sum, the Avenger Justice automates a very tough system of controlling
- PK (player killing). Potentially, an oppressor who kills someone will find
- himself dying twice each time he subsequently kills that victim within a
- 30 day period (assuming the victim never makes a hostile action in
- return). If that person attacks a victim unprovoked but fails to kill that
- victim, he will still find himself dying to the Avenger (even if the
- victim turns the tables and kills the oppressor, the oppressor will die
- twice, once to the victim and once to the Avenger). Invoking the Avenger
- is optional and a name on the Vengeance list will be deleted from the list if
- not invoked after the 30 day limit on the name expires.
- EXCEPTIONS:
- o The Avenger will NOT protect you if you die on another plane.
- Travel to other planes at your own risk. Also, the Avenger will NOT
- protect you if you enter territory where you've been declared an enemy.
- These are "open PK" zones. As stated above, suspect status will not be
- dropped when you attack suspects in open PK zones.
- o If you get yourself on the suspect list of 15 or more people then each
- additional time you get on a suspect list, your victim will also get an
- immediate chance of vengeance.
- o During events of crisis and conflict, the Avenger recognises the need
- to let combat unfold without interference. Whenever this is the case,
- you will be notified upon login, and surveying in an area will tell
- you if the Avenger is not protecting that area.
